     17 package com.android.settings.location;
     18 
     19 import android.preference.PreferenceScreen;
     20 import android.provider.Settings;
     21 
     22 import com.android.settings.R;
     23 
     24 /**
     25  * A page with 3 radio buttons to choose the location mode.
     26  *
     27  * There are 3 location modes when location access is enabled:
     28  *
     29  * High accuracy: use both GPS and network location.
     30  *
     31  * Battery saving: use network location only to reduce the power consumption.
     32  *
     33  * Sensors only: use GPS location only.
     34  */
     35 public class LocationMode extends LocationSettingsBase
     36         implements RadioButtonPreference.OnClickListener {
     37     private static final String KEY_HIGH_ACCURACY = "high_accuracy";
     38     private RadioButtonPreference mHighAccuracy;
     39     private static final String KEY_BATTERY_SAVING = "battery_saving";
     40     private RadioButtonPreference mBatterySaving;
     41     private static final String KEY_SENSORS_ONLY = "sensors_only";
     42     private RadioButtonPreference mSensorsOnly;
     43 
     44     @Override
     45     public void onResume() {
     46         super.onResume();
     47         createPreferenceHierarchy();
     48     }
     49 
     50     @Override
     51     public void onPause() {
     52         super.onPause();
     53     }
     54 
     55     private PreferenceScreen createPreferenceHierarchy() {
     56         PreferenceScreen root = getPreferenceScreen();
     57         if (root != null) {
     58             root.removeAll();
     59         }
     60         addPreferencesFromResource(R.xml.location_mode);
     61         root = getPreferenceScreen();
     62 
     63         mHighAccuracy = (RadioButtonPreference) root.findPreference(KEY_HIGH_ACCURACY);
     64         mBatterySaving = (RadioButtonPreference) root.findPreference(KEY_BATTERY_SAVING);
     65         mSensorsOnly = (RadioButtonPreference) root.findPreference(KEY_SENSORS_ONLY);
     66         mHighAccuracy.setOnClickListener(this);
     67         mBatterySaving.setOnClickListener(this);
     68         mSensorsOnly.setOnClickListener(this);
     69 
     70         refreshLocationMode();
     71         return root;
     72     }
     73 
     74     private void updateRadioButtons(RadioButtonPreference activated) {
     75         if (activated == null) {
     76             mHighAccuracy.setChecked(false);
     77             mBatterySaving.setChecked(false);
     78             mSensorsOnly.setChecked(false);
     79         } else if (activated == mHighAccuracy) {
     80             mHighAccuracy.setChecked(true);
     81             mBatterySaving.setChecked(false);
     82             mSensorsOnly.setChecked(false);
     83         } else if (activated == mBatterySaving) {
     84             mHighAccuracy.setChecked(false);
     85             mBatterySaving.setChecked(true);
     86             mSensorsOnly.setChecked(false);
     87         } else if (activated == mSensorsOnly) {
     88             mHighAccuracy.setChecked(false);
     89             mBatterySaving.setChecked(false);
     90             mSensorsOnly.setChecked(true);
     91         }
     92     }
     93 
     94     @Override
     95     public void onRadioButtonClicked(RadioButtonPreference emiter) {
     96         int mode = Settings.Secure.LOCATION_MODE_OFF;
     97         if (emiter == mHighAccuracy) {
     98             mode = Settings.Secure.LOCATION_MODE_HIGH_ACCURACY;
     99         } else if (emiter == mBatterySaving) {
    100             mode = Settings.Secure.LOCATION_MODE_BATTERY_SAVING;
    101         } else if (emiter == mSensorsOnly) {
    102             mode = Settings.Secure.LOCATION_MODE_SENSORS_ONLY;
    103         }
    104         setLocationMode(mode);
    105     }
    106 
    107     @Override
    108     public void onModeChanged(int mode, boolean restricted) {
    109         switch (mode) {
    110             case Settings.Secure.LOCATION_MODE_OFF:
    111                 updateRadioButtons(null);
    112                 break;
    113             case Settings.Secure.LOCATION_MODE_SENSORS_ONLY:
    114                 updateRadioButtons(mSensorsOnly);
    115                 break;
    116             case Settings.Secure.LOCATION_MODE_BATTERY_SAVING:
    117                 updateRadioButtons(mBatterySaving);
    118                 break;
    119             case Settings.Secure.LOCATION_MODE_HIGH_ACCURACY:
    120                 updateRadioButtons(mHighAccuracy);
    121                 break;
    122             default:
    123                 break;
    124         }
    125 
    126         boolean enabled = (mode != Settings.Secure.LOCATION_MODE_OFF) && !restricted;
    127         mHighAccuracy.setEnabled(enabled);
    128         mBatterySaving.setEnabled(enabled);
    129         mSensorsOnly.setEnabled(enabled);
    130     }
    131 
    132     @Override
    133     public int getHelpResource() {
    134         return R.string.help_url_location_access;
    135     }
    136 }
